Using TRICARE for rehab near Peoria

Know your TRICARE plan type

Active-duty plans, Reserve/Guard plans, and retiree coverage (TRICARE Prime, Select, and For Life) have different rules for which facilities count as in-network and what you pay out of pocket. Call the facility and have your specific TRICARE plan name and ID card ready so they can verify your eligibility before you apply.

131 providers near Peoria report TRICARE

Peoria has 131 treatment centers that report accepting TRICARE, spanning medical detox, inpatient residential care, partial hospitalization, intensive outpatient, and medication-assisted treatment. Ask each program whether they are in-network under your plan and what the typical wait time is before slots open.

What to do if out of network

If the program you prefer is out of network, ask whether TRICARE will authorize out-of-network care and what your cost-share would be—coverage and approval depend on your specific plan and the program's clinical credentials. Some plans allow self-referral; others require prior authorization.

Gather your plan details first

Before calling a treatment center, confirm your current deductible and whether you've met it this year, since that affects what you'll owe upfront. Your TRICARE statement or the online portal shows your plan summary—bring it to the admission conversation.

Before You Call: Getting Ready and Checking Coverage

Before you call a treatment center, have your TRICARE ID and sponsor information ready—the program will need it to check what your specific plan covers. Bring details about any prior treatment, current medications, and whether you have Arizona Medicaid or another insurance running alongside TRICARE. Many centers in the Peoria area can verify your benefits on the spot, which means you'll know upfront whether they're in-network, what your out-of-pocket costs may look like, and how long you might wait for admission. Recovery Dawn is a free referral service and can help connect you with programs that accept TRICARE, but only the center and TRICARE can confirm your exact coverage.

If the program you prefer is out-of-network, ask whether they can file for a TRICARE exception or whether you can appeal through your TRICARE region for authorization—some Arizona providers have pathways for this, especially if no in-network option meets your clinical needs. Arizona Medicaid can run concurrently with TRICARE and may fill coverage gaps or reduce your cost-share; the treatment center's admissions team can clarify how both plans work together. Verify your benefits directly with TRICARE before your first appointment to avoid surprises on arrival day.

Common questions about TRICARE coverage in Peoria, AZ

Does TRICARE cover rehab in Peoria?

TRICARE covers a range of addiction and mental-health treatment services, and plans commonly include inpatient and residential rehab, outpatient programs, medication-assisted treatment, and dual-diagnosis care. However, coverage varies significantly by your specific TRICARE plan and policy, so you'll need to verify your own benefits directly with TRICARE or your plan administrator to confirm what's covered for you.

Can I find rehab near me that takes TRICARE in Peoria, AZ?

In Peoria, most treatment facilities report accepting TRICARE as a payment source, giving you solid access to in-network options in or near the city. To find which specific providers are in your TRICARE network, contact your plan or ask the facility directly during intake—being in-network typically means lower out-of-pocket costs than out-of-network care.

How do I verify TRICARE benefits for rehab?

Call your TRICARE customer service number or log into your member portal to review your addiction and mental-health benefits. Ask specifically about your deductible, copays, coinsurance, and whether pre-authorization is required for the level of care you're seeking—inpatient, outpatient, or another type. Write down the answers and your member ID before calling a treatment facility.

What is pre-authorization and do I need it for TRICARE rehab in Peoria?

Pre-authorization means TRICARE reviews your treatment plan in advance to confirm coverage before you begin care. The treatment provider usually requests this on your behalf, but you can also submit the request directly—your TRICARE plan materials will show how. Pre-auth can affect wait times, so confirm the process with your chosen facility early.

What if the treatment facility I want doesn't take TRICARE?

If a facility you prefer doesn't accept TRICARE, you may still receive care and file a claim yourself, but you'll likely pay out-of-pocket upfront and seek reimbursement later. Out-of-network care typically costs more than in-network, so comparing what you'll owe before treatment starts is important—ask the facility for an estimate and confirm your out-of-network benefits with TRICARE.

What types of rehab does TRICARE cover in Peoria?

Peoria-area providers commonly offer outpatient rehab, virtual and telehealth options, dual-diagnosis and co-occurring disorder treatment, and ongoing aftercare and recovery support. The level of care right for you depends on your specific needs—your doctor, TRICARE member services, or the treatment facility can help you decide.

What is the admissions process for TRICARE rehab in Peoria?

Contact the treatment facility and ask whether they handle the pre-authorization request with TRICARE or if you need to submit it yourself. Have your TRICARE member ID ready, confirm your plan type with the facility's admissions team, and ask how long the authorization typically takes—this helps you understand your timeline and next steps.

How much does rehab cost with TRICARE in Peoria?

TRICARE coverage and out-of-pocket costs depend entirely on your specific plan, deductible, copays, and whether you use in-network or out-of-network providers. Never assume a quoted price—verify your actual benefits with TRICARE and ask the facility for a cost estimate based on your coverage before you enroll.

About Peoria, AZ

Peoria sits on the northwest edge of the Phoenix metro area, spanning from established communities like Arrowhead Ranch and Fletcher Heights to newer master-planned areas such as Vistancia and Sunrise Mountain. It's a spread-out, car-dependent city where wide arterial roads connect residential neighborhoods to shopping centers, hospitals, and office parks. Healthcare, retail, and municipal government are major local employers, alongside schools and manufacturing. Every spring, the Peoria Sports Complex draws crowds for Padres and Mariners training camp, energizing the P83 entertainment district. Beyond that, the desert landscape and mountain views give the city a quieter, residential feel compared to central Phoenix.
